Paxil (Paroxetine)

Paxil is a sel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or (SSRI) . Paxil (Paroxetine) is used to treat depression, social anxiety disorder (social phobia), panic attacks, ob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D), post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D), and generalized anxiety disorders (GAD).Paxil affects chemicals in the brain that may become unbalanced and cause depression, panic, anxiety, or obsessive-compulsive symptoms.

Paxil dosage:

Take Paxil (paroxetine) exactly as directed by your doctor. It may take several weeks of treatment before you start feeling better .
The usual starting dose is 20 milligrams a day, taken as a single dose, usually in the morning.
